当前位置:Gxlcms > 数据库问题 > mysql导出表结构到excel

mysql导出表结构到excel

时间:2021-07-01 10:21:17 帮助过:19人阅读

执行sql:

SELECT
f.TABLE_NAME 表名,
f.TABLE_COMMENT 表注释,
t.COLUMN_NAME 字段名称,
t.COLUMN_TYPE 数据类型,
t.COLUMN_KEY 约束1PRI主键约束2UNI唯一约束2MUI可以重复索引,
t.IS_NULLABLE 是否为空,
t.COLUMN_COMMENT 字段注释,
t.COLLATION_NAME 使用字符集,
t.DATA_TYPE 字段类型,
t.EXTRA 额外配置
FROM(
SELECT
sch.TABLE_SCHEMA,
sch.TABLE_NAME,
sch.TABLE_COMMENT
FROM information_schema.`TABLES` sch
WHERE TABLE_SCHEMA=‘db_promote‘
-- 加上可过滤到表
-- AND TABLE_NAME=‘t_users‘
) f
LEFT JOIN information_schema.COLUMNS t ON f.TABLE_SCHEMA=t.TABLE_SCHEMA AND f.TABLE_NAME=t.TABLE_NAME

展示效果:

技术图片

 

mysql导出表结构到excel

标签:mic   mysql导出   schema   comm   注释   where   类型   额外   tab   

人气教程排行